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
905 68967729231 266315
71814 99817742 2227617104
71814 99817742 2227617104
69 08 155 3408217855
All about undefined
Interested in learning more?
71814 99817742 2227617104
69 08 155 3408217855
See more
755938 4203368273 94433310
5866 663338 686 98526662388 78
See more
14467123520 808 80166806204
0261520 32 75
See more